A code summary should accompany all cardiac arrest reports. Attach both strips to the completed run report.Upon arrival to the emergency department and after transferring the patient to the hospital’s bed/gurney obtain a second strip demonstrating a continued positive wave form.Document any airway or pharmacologic interventions based on capnography readings. The Alaris EtCO2 module is a side stream capnograph used for continuous, noninvasive measurement of exhaled and inhaled carbon dioxide concentration over.Upon confirmation of successful endotracheal intubation or King Tube placement (positive wave form), print a strip and document the initial reading on the abbreviated report.Capnography device should remain in place for continuous monitoring, with frequent checks to ascertain that the tube does not migrate.
